...g, [approx], True, (0, 0, 255), 2) cv2.imshow(show,img) cv2.waitKey() 5凸包 凸包看起来类似轮廓近似,但是它不是(两者在某些情况下可能提供相同的结果). convexHull(points[, hull[, clockwise[, returnPoints]]]):检查曲线的凸性缺陷并进行修正. points:......
...APM 审校整理: 1,Find Convex Hull with Graham Scan & Swift 导读:凸包(Convex hull) 是一个数学上的概念,在二维平面上可以想象成用一个橡皮筋套住一堆钉在平面上的钉子。本文讲述如何使用 Swift 实现 Graham scan 算法来寻找二维平面点集...
...)采用B样条(B-Splines)来细分多边形的曲线,该曲线通常在凸包线的内部。 函数格式为: skimage.measure.subdivide_polygon(coords,degree=2,preserve_ends=False)
... rect_area = w*h extent = float(area)/rect_area 3 Solidity 轮廓面积与凸包面积的比 $$ Extent = frac{Contou Area}{Convex Hull Area} $$ area = cv.contourArea(cnt) hull = cv.convexHull(cnt) hull_area = cv.contou...
...点,终点,最远点,到最远点的近似距离]NOTE:必须在找到凸包时传递returnPoints = False,以便找到凸起缺陷. 代码: import cv2 import numpy as np img = cv2.imread(img7.png) img_gray = cv2.cvtColor(img,cv2.COLOR_BGR2GRAY) ret,thresh = cv2.thre...
... centerY + sin * (x - centerX) + cos * (y - centerY)); } 凸包算法实现 Geometry hull = (new ConvexHull(geom)).getConvexHull(); 获得结果 public static Polygon get(Geometry geom, GeometryFac...
...。 轮廓具有许多其他可以使用的功能,例如轮廓周长,凸包,边界矩形等等。您可以从这里了解更多相关信息。 def findGreatesContour(contours): largest_area = 0 largest_contour_index = -1 i = 0 total_contours = len(contours...
...。 轮廓具有许多其他可以使用的功能,例如轮廓周长,凸包,边界矩形等等。您可以从这里了解更多相关信息。 def findGreatesContour(contours): largest_area = 0 largest_contour_index = -1 i = 0 total_contours = len(contours...
ChatGPT和Sora等AI大模型应用,将AI大模型和算力需求的热度不断带上新的台阶。哪里可以获得...
大模型的训练用4090是不合适的,但推理(inference/serving)用4090不能说合适,...
图示为GPU性能排行榜,我们可以看到所有GPU的原始相关性能图表。同时根据训练、推理能力由高到低做了...